Substrate specificity tests of Arabidopsis isovaleryl-CoA dehydrogenase (IVD) expressed in Escherichia coli showed a strong preference toward isovaleryl-CoA but also show considerable activity with isobutyryl-CoA. This strongly indicates that this enzyme has parallel activity towards isovaleryl-CoA and isobutyryl-CoA, thus involved in both pathways- leucine and valine catabolism. Such dual activity has not been observed with the animal IVD and may suggest a novel connection of the Leu and valine catabolism in plants.
